    Ingredients Needed

    Brownie Mix - You can choose whatever kind of brownie mix you love. I used a Ghiradelli chocolate brownie mix because we love the flavor of Ghiradelli. You can also use a Betty Crocker mix or other brands.

    Egg

    Vegetable Oil

    Optional add-ins - chocolate chips, nuts, peanut butter chips, or sprinkles.

    Equipment Needed

    Baking Sheet - I like to use baking sheets with sides so there is no way I can be clumsy and have the cookies slide right off into the oven {not that I want to admit that it has happened but I did learn my lesson.}

    Parchment Paper -ย  I love that I can use parchment paper to help make it easier to remove the brownie cookies. They also make clean-up a breeze. If you are not using parchment paper you will want to spray non-stick cooking spray on your baking sheet to help the cookies not stick.

    Hand Mixer - I am a huge fan of using a hand mixer to get everything mixed together while baking. This dough is thick so a hand mixer makes it a lot easier to work with.

    Large Mixing Bowl - We are big fans of this glass batter bowl that has a handle. It makes it easy to mix ingredients and keeps the mixing bowl steady on the counter.

    Cookie Scoop - Cookie scoops are the perfect tool to make sure you get even cookies.

    Cooling Rack - A cooling rack is a great way to cool the cookies down.

    Recipe Tips

    If you like fudgier brownies you can add 1 additional egg yolk to the mix. This will make the brownie cookies a bit softer and taste more like the chewy center of a brownie.

    This dough is thick! I like to use a spatula to scoop any brownie mix off of the bottom of the bowl and press it into the dough when I am mixing everything together. This helps incorporate all of the ingredients.

    You can add in chocolate chips if you want even more chocolate flavor in your brownie cookies.

    These cookies take between 9-10 minutes baking time depending on your oven. I set my oven for 9 minutes and then check to see if they are done. I like crunchier edges so sometimes I leave them in for a bit longer cook time.

    I have not tried making these with a gluten-free box of brownie mix yet so I am not sure if the times or temperature will need to be adjusted. I am hoping to make them soon.

    Don't forget to preheat the oven.

    Brownie Mix Cookies

    How to make easy 3 Ingredient Brownie Mix Cookies. These chocolate brownie cookies are so easy to make and taste amazing.
    2.70 from 13 votes
    Print Rate
    Prep Time: 10 minutes minutes
    Cook Time: 10 minutes minutes
    Total Time: 20 minutes minutes
    Servings: 21 Cookies
    Calories: 155kcal
    Author: Tammilee Tips

    Ingredients

    • 18 Ounce Brownie Mix
    • ยฝ cup Vegetable Oil
    • 1 egg

    Instructions

    • Preheat oven to 350 degrees
    • Mix ingredients together and scoop onto a parchment lined baking sheet
    • Bake for 9-10 minutes
